Most touch screens are capacitive - meaning they detect the change in capacitance that is introduced by touching them. Insulators generally do not introduce a large enough change in capacitance to trigger the touch screen. So if your fingers are turning to papery stumps somehow, you wont be able to trigger it.

WebJun 29, 2024 · The reason some touchscreens only work with a bare finger lies in the human body’s naturally conductive properties. Capacitive touchscreens such as these rely on conductivity to detect touch commands. If you use a gloved finger or a stylus to control them, they won’t register or otherwise respond to your commands. But in general, they all work by using an array of sensors to monitor the electrostatic field around the screen. When your finger touches the screen, it changes the electrical capacitance of that portion of the screen. ready or not free trial
